#J524 Myra Kingsley the No. 1 Astrologer
American astrologer described as "the No. 1 astrologer of the U.S." in an article in LIFE magazine ("Hollywood Likes Myra Kingsley's Horoscopes," 7 August 1939), it appears in full below.
